The Truth About Us by Megan D. Martin

3.0

Rowan Steele lied to the love of her life, and broke of their hearts in the process. Rowan and her ex have both tried to move on, but are drawn back together. This book explores whether the truth is better left unsaid. The book itself is really well written and the plot had great beginnings, it just seemed rushed at the end and could have been executed a lot better. I love a good romance, particularly when like this where true love doesn’t run smoothly. I just think a lot more could be done here than was actually offered.
